Plant Healthcare Tech | Chesterfield, MI (Chesterfield, MI, US, 48051)
The Davey Tree Expert Company

Lawn Care Spray Tech | Frazier's Bottom, WV (Fraziers Bottom, WV, US, 25082)
The Davey Tree Expert Company
